> On Mon, Sep 21, 2015 at 06:25:31PM +0200, wm4 wrote:
> > If cmd_pos is broken, this would just keep accumulating packets in the
> > reassembly buffer, until it fails and flushes the buffer on overflow.
> > Since packets are usually rather small, this will take a lot of subtitle
> > packets. The perceived effect is that subtitles are not displayed
> > anymore after the faulty packet was passed to the decoder.
> >
> > I'm not terribly sure about this, but on the other hand this code is
> > active only when fragmented packets need to be reassembled.
> >
> > Fixes sample file in trac issue #4872.

> is this correct for the big_offsets == 1 case ?
> iam asking as big_offsets == 1 implies that AV_RB16(buf) == 0
Good point. Likely it does have a 4 byte command offset, but starting
at byte 2. Does anyone have a HD sample?
> also does someone have a link to a specification or something?
From what I've gathered, the DVD spec exists only in printed form, and
was never leaked.
